Manipula 软件支持的工艺列表
概述
Manipula 机器人离线编程与仿真软件支持多种工艺类型,涵盖从基础工序操作到复杂应用领域的完整工艺链。本列表整理软件支持的所有工艺类型,包括工序类型、加工方法、应用领域等。
一、工序类型
1.1 基本工序类型
- 复合工序:手动创建的工序,可包含通用工序和复合连续工序作为子工序
- 通用工序:手动创建并通过示教添加指令的工序,可设置为复合工序或复合连续工序的子工序
- 复合连续工序:基于选定加工几何自动创建,包含多个曲线工序
- 曲线工序:基于曲线、边线或面的等参线创建,存在于复合连续工序中
1.2 工序创建方式
- 手动创建:通过示教功能直接在机器人任务中创建并编辑路径指令
- 自动生成:基于选定加工几何和投影参数自动生成工序路径
二、面区域加工工艺
2.1 单面等参线工序
- 功能:使用等参线覆盖单个面,生成加工曲线和工序
- 特点:
- 支持U或V方向的等参线生成
- 可控制曲线方向和顺序
- 提供修剪与延伸功能
- 支持等距偏移和比例延伸
- 参数配置:
- 步距模式:等距或次数控制
- 运动模式:单向或往复运动
2.2 连续面等参线工序
- 功能:用连续的等参线覆盖多个连续的面
- 特点:
- 自动关联曲线所在的面作为投影面
- 支持自动选择相邻面或相切面
- 可合并相连的等参线为一条曲线
- 选择模式:
- 单独选择面
- 自动选择相邻面
- 自动选择相切面
2.3 基于截面线创建连续工序
- 功能:用连续的截面线覆盖多个连续的面
- 特点:
- 支持X、Y、Z轴方向的截面法线
- 提供多种面选择模式
- 可设置修剪与延伸参数
2.4 径向面工序
- 功能:基于引导线创建径向覆盖基准面的加工曲线
- 引导线类型:
- 内部边界:基于面的内边界进行采样取点
- 相交边:基于基准面和侧面的交线进行采样取点
- 特点:
- 支持自适应间距或次数控制的驱动设置
- 可反转曲线顺序和方向
三、边线加工工艺
3.1 创建曲线工序
- 功能:基于选定的曲线生成加工工序
- 特点:
- 支持多种参考平面(XY、YZ、ZX平面或自定义平面)
- 可在3D视图中直接选择加工曲线
- 提供曲线反向和删除功能
3.2 创建边工序
- 功能:通过选择面的边线创建连续工序
- 选择模式:
- 选择单个边线
- 自动选择相切边线(支持角度阈值设置)
- 特点:
- 可合并相连的曲线为一条曲线
- 支持边线方向反转
- 显示边线关联面的法线方向
四、曲面相交线加工工艺
4.1 基于曲面相交线创建连续工序
- 功能:选择两组面,基于它们的相交线创建加工曲线和工序
- 特点:
- 自动关联生成相交线的两个面作为焊缝投影的基准面和侧壁面
- 适用于焊接、粘接等需要精确控制路径的应用
五、工序投影工艺
5.1 投影功能
- 功能:将加工几何转换为机器人目标点(Target)
- 投影对象:单个连续工序或复合连续工序
- 特点:
- 保存全部投影参数,便于重复应用或调整
- 自动加载之前的投影参数
5.2 姿态计算方式
- 路径跟随:
- 固定方向:所有目标点采用同一组旋转角度(工作角α、行进角β、旋转角γ)
- 线性插值:起始点和结束点的角度进行线性插值
- 球面插补:
- 绕Z轴旋转控制:启用或禁用工具X轴随路径变化的旋转
- 旋转角:定义初始方向偏置
- 结束旋转角:定义结束方向偏置
5.3 位置偏移
- 法向偏移:沿目标点法向轴偏移的距离
- 侧向偏移:沿目标点侧向轴偏移的距离
5.4 目标轴设置
- 轴对应关系:将目标点的XYZ轴分别对应为法向轴、运动轴、侧向轴
- 运动轴方向模式:
- 对齐:目标点的运动轴总是顺着加工曲线的切向
- 交替:以间隔工序的方式顺着和逆着加工曲线的切向
六、高级工艺功能
6.1 插值功能
- 目标姿态插值:在两个目标点之间插值目标姿态,平滑过渡方向
- 外部轴位置插值:在两个参考目标点之间均匀插值外部轴值
- 配置参数自动设置:根据首目标点参数自动设置选定范围内目标点的配置参数
6.2 投影参数配置
- 目标点间距:指定生成的目标点之间沿加工曲线的距离
- 运动参数:
- 速度:直线运动速度设置
- 转角半径:运动中经过目标点时的转角半径
- WorkObject:使用的工件坐标系
- 工具数据:使用的工具数据
总结
Manipula软件提供全面的工艺支持,涵盖从基础工序操作到复杂应用领域的完整工艺链。软件支持多种加工方法、丰富的参数配置和高级工艺功能,能够满足工业机器人离线编程的各种需求。
注:本列表基于软件手册内容整理,涵盖了Manipula软件支持的主要工艺类型。具体功能可能随软件版本更新而有所变化。